    After upgrading my iPhone to iOS 8, when I connect my iPhone 4S on my car via USB, the radio system tries to recognize it as an iPod as always. But after 10 seconds the system switches to FM showing some iPod error message. The iPhone continues to charge but no connection with the radio system is stablished. For me, the solution was:

     

    Start the Music app, play any music and then connect the cable. It doesn't work with any other music app, I tried some of them including Spotify. If you just start the Music app and don't play any music, when you plug the cable the connection will not establish as well.

     

    As I said, I had this problem with my old iPhone 4S. I live in Brazil and my radio system is provided by Fiat (Punto Sporting 2015).

    Sadly, the bluetooth connection through the Viseeo tune2air would not allow me to connect the iPhone 6 to the sound system in my Aston. It has exactly the same problem as when I plug the phone in using the 30 pin cable with a 30pin to lightning adapter -- the car systems simply says "iPod Unreadable".

     

    The iPhone 6 itself will not play any music when connected to the car (whether connected by cable or, I have now discovered, by bluetooth using the tune2air).  If if press play on the iPhone 6 when it is connected to the car it just jumps straight back to pause.  If I unplug the phone or switch off the bluetooth connection, the iPhone plays music itself without problem.

     

    Clearly, iOS8 and the Premium Sound System in the Aston are just totally incompatible.  A great shame given that iOS7 and before worked perfectly with the system in the Aston.  iOS8 just says no to all functionality when connected to the car.

     

    There is no message on the phone itself when I connect it to the car, only a message on the screen in the car.  The iPhone just won't play when connected to the car as said ahove -- it will just jump straight back to pause if I press play on any track when connected to the car.

     

    The only connection that works in the analogue connection using the hedphone socket on the phone and the 3.7m aux-in on the car.  Sound is not as sharp or clear as a digital signal, so some detail is lost, and the volume needs to be cranked all the way up on the phone to generate a strong enough signal to get a reasonable level of volume out of the car without cranking the volume on the car all the up.   No ability to control the phone through the system though when connected this way, so this is clearly a less than ideal work around by some considerable margin.

    Curiously, after days of trying various things, my iPhone 6 now will connect to my car by bluetooth and by cable.

     

    Having tried everything, I decided once more to reset the phone to factory settings and reload iOS8.0.2.  I then set the phone up as new and did not sync it with iTunes.  I downloaded a couple of songs from iCloud only to the music app but did not put anything else on the phone.

     

    I then attempted to connect the phone to the car and it connected instantly and will connect by bluetooth and by cable.  I get full functionality again, can scroll songs and can even skips tracks when streaming on Google Play Music.

     

    I have not yet sync'd with iTunes but will, I think, just load the apps again from iCloud manually (one at a time) and see if any of them were causing the bug.  Will be a painful, long and boring process but at least the phone is now connecting to the car as it should.

     

    Once I have done that I will try to load my photos and all the other stuff from iTunes but will not restore from backup.  Just need to remember how to connect to iTunes without the automatic sync firing up.  I read this is possible but can't recall now how to do it.

     

    If you have not tried factory reset in this manner, it is worth a go.  But don't restore from back up or iCloud.  Set up as a new phone, download one or two songs from iTunes (without syncing with iTunes) and see if that works.
